DEAF Social A whitewashed Kings Club C to extend their lead at the top of Warrington Snooker League's third division to a whopping 15 points.
GTBL B dropped to third spot after losing 6-1 to Monk D.
As a result, second place now belongs to Woolston C, who returned to winning ways this week with a 7-0 demolition of Deaf Social B.
Irlam Cons moved into pole position in Division One with a 5-2 win against Walkers B.
Previous leaders Snookers A lost to GTBL A by the same score and third-placed Newton Social suffered a 4-3 defeat at the hands of Roosters C.
At the other end of the table, St Josephs' revival suffered a setback when they lost 5-2 at Alford D.
Roosters A stayed on course for the Division Two title with an impressive win against second-placed Alliance A.
Jimmy Murray lost his first game of the season as Roosters opened up an eight-point cushion at the top of the table.
Third-placed Alford B won 4-3 at Roosters D. They lead Penketh Legion B, who trounced Snookers C 6-1, by a single point.
